DATEADD関数とは?SQLでの日付計算・期間算出の基本

DATEADD関数は指定された時間間隔を日付に追加するために使用されます。基本的な構文は以下の通りです:

DATEADD(datepart, number, date)

datepartパラメータは、日付に追加する時間間隔(年、月、日など)を指定します。numberパラメータは追加する量を指定し、dateパラメータは時間間隔を追加する初期日付を指定します。

例えば、現在の日付に30日を追加したい場合は、以下のクエリを使用できます。

SELECT DATEADD(day, 30, GETDATE())

現在の日付に30日を加えた日付が返されます。よく使われるdatepartパラメーターには、次のものがあります:

  1. 年:year
  2. 月:月份
  3. 日:天空
  4. 時間:時。
  5. 一分間: 分
  6. following in japanese:seconds:秒

DATEADD関数を使用することで、日付の加算や減算を簡単に行うことができ、一般的な時間処理の要求を実現することができます。

bannerAds